“PAWS” & BRUNCH TO BE HELD FOR THIRD TIME AT EL SANTO

Sociable doggy friendly event is proving popular with Glasgow’s dog loving community

It’s back for a third time!  El Santo Latin American Restaurant in Miller Steet, Glasgow, is once again laying on its weekend Paws & Brunch event for dog lovers everywhere!

Partnering with Sir Woofchester, a company specialising in canine hospitality, the next Paws & Brunch event will take place at El Santo on Saturday, the 18th of July, from 12 noon to 3pm.

All dogs attending will receive a canine afternoon tea, consisting of an iced pupcake, bark bangers, a Paw Star Martini and a Woof Bar. El Santo will provide blankets, water bowls, toys and a comfortable environment for dogs to relax throughout the event – so that their loving owners can fully relax too.

They can enjoy three dishes from El Santos Latin inspired tapas menu, plus a glass of Prosecco on arrival, or a soft drink alternative. A professional photographer will be on hand to capture the event for owners, as a lasting memento of the day.

Dog lover and El Santo Events Coordinator, Vira Romashova, who is behind the innovative event, said she was thrilled to see the event on to its third date: “We are really starting to build a following for this concept, with some customers coming back for a third time, as they have met and bonded with other dog lovers at the previous two brunches.”

“I came up with this concept because I know from personal experience that sometimes dog owners, and their dogs, find it difficult to fully relax when they are out socially. Sometimes it’s the dog that doesn’t settle in the environment, stressing out the owner,” added Vira, who, along with working in events, has looked after dogs professionally for nine years.

“It struck me that when I joined El Santo, I could create an event that was designed specifically for both people and dogs together. Rather than simply allowing dogs, Paws & Brunch is built entirely around them. We allocate a dedicated space in the restaurant to them. It really helps the dogs settle, and they have room to play with their favourite toys.”

“Anyone is welcome to attend Paws& Brunch though, you don’t to bring a dog with you. We also welcome children, so it can be a real family affair.”

Vira thanked Sir Woofchester for partnering El Santo in the event.

“They are a brilliant company to partner with, as their doggy products are delicious, with even the fussiest pooches loving them.”

She finished by saying that Worq Hospitality, El Santo’s parent company, was very much a dog friendly business.

“Our Managing Director, Jonathan, has a very friendly British bulldog, named El Santo, that he’s been bringing into the office for ages. He’s our office mascot!”

“So loving dogs is at the heart of these events which we want to make a permanent fixture on the vibrant El Santo events calendar. We would love your four legged friend to become part of our growing doggy community!”
